Clinical Practice Specialization
My clinical practice specialization focuses on using different psychotherapuetic theories along with
natural methods of healing. The idea of combining psychotherapy with natural therapies dates back to ancient times.
Hippocrates, a physician and philosopher who lived 2400 years ago, was one of the first to claim that emotional health
had a physiological and natural basis.
He often prescribed natural therapies, using nutrition, herbs, and various lifestyle changes.
It is interesting to note that Hippocrates is considered the father of both modern medicine and
naturopathic medicine, having coined the phrase "the healing power of nature."
